About the Role

The RN Clinical Nurse is an integral member of an interdisciplinary team providing individualized, high-quality, and safe patient care in a clinical setting. They practice according to professional standards, including the Georgia Nurse Practice Act and ANA Code of Ethics, emphasizing patient advocacy and system policies.

Responsibilities

  • Perform the nursing process—assessment, diagnosis, planning, implementation, and evaluation—using evidence-based practices and critical thinking.
  • Deliver relationship-based, patient-centered care tailored to diverse populations and cultural needs.
  • Partner with patients and families through effective communication, education, and goal-setting.
  • Coordinate and document safe, quality care, fostering teamwork and respectful interdisciplinary collaboration.
  • Participate in performance improvement, research, and evidence-based practice initiatives.
  • Support professional development as a preceptor or mentor, and uphold organizational policies and safety standards.
  • Contribute to protocol development, resource management, and patient care across the continuum.

Requirements

  • Associate's Degree or Diploma in Nursing; Bachelor's preferred.
  • Current RN licensure (single state or multi-state compact).
  • Minimum of 5 years of direct patient care experience.
  • Required certifications include BLS, NRP, and relevant licensure.
